怎么将数据导入到mysql数据库中

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了怎么将数据导入到mysql数据库中相关的知识,希望对你有一定的参考价值。

步骤如下:
首先使用mysql提供的命令行界面来导入数据库,确保自己的电脑中安装了MySQL数据库,可以通过命令行来确认是否安装了MySQL数据库,当然,第一步是打开Mysql的数据库服务,使用命令行来打开:如下图所示:

启动MySQL后,找到需要用到的脚本文件,也就是数据库文件,首先得建立一个数据库,这样才可以导入脚本,如下图所示:

在将脚本拷到本地磁盘的根目录,这样方便进入找到脚本,这里以D盘来说明,使用test.sql:接着来到命令行,使用SOURCE d:/test.sql;来导入数据库,先进入mysql,如下图所示:

首先要在数据库中建立好数据库,然后导入脚本,所以先建立一个数据库,不要脚本是不知道要往哪个数据库中导入脚本的,如下图所示:

然后就可以输入导入.sql文件命令:
mysql> USE 数据库名;
mysql> SOURCE d:/test.sql;

如下图所示:

看到上面的画面,说明mysql数据库已经导入成功了。
参考技术A 1.将选中的数据快儿拷贝到一个TXT文本文件中(记得把后面的空格消掉。。否则导入数据库后会有对应的空行),假如存到“D:\data.txt”这个位置里。
2.根据要导入的数据快儿建立MySql数据库和表,然后进入命令提示符里使用命令
load data local infile 'D:/data.txt' into table exceltomysql fields terminated by '\t';
注意:盘符我使用的“/”才成功,否则提示找不到文件 下面文章中是用的“\”!
进行导入操作
手动进行Excel数据和MySql数据转换
参考技术B 首先我们需要在mysql管理工具上面新建一个表,也可以用mysql命令创建,表建立完成之后,你需要将表中的字段名字告诉给填写excel表的人员.
打开excel表,按照程序提供的字段填写相应的数据.此时注意下面几点:名字(我用红色标示出来了)需要跟程序提供的一样,其他的描述,表头可以不写都行.
我使用的mysql管理工具是Navicat for MySQL,打开工具,选择表所在的数据库,然后点击数据库名字,右键数据,出来下拉菜单选择import wizard ,有汉化版本的更明确.弹出一个选择界面,我们选择excel file文件
点击next(下一步),我们选择我们对应的excel文件就行,然后再下面选在我们的文件内容在哪一个sheet中,也就是你的内容写在excel什么地方,这点需要注意,也是关键的地方,我的内容在sheet3中,所以我选择sheet3 ,如图:
点击next (此步骤也是关键步骤),需要注意2点: 1:filed name row 就是你的字段所在excel中的位置,也就是第几行(简单办法,一般就是英文对应的那一列).2:first data row(从哪一行开始执行),数据从哪一行开始呢,我这里选择的是3,4.
点击next 我们选择 target table 目标对应的数据库,选择你要导入到哪个数据库中表中.

如何将access数据库 导入到 navicat for MySQL 中

参考技术A 1.首先连接Mysql
2.右击空白处,选择导入向导 
3.选择导入类型:MS ACCESS数据库(*.mdb,*.accdb)点击下一步
4.浏览一个MDB数据库文件,打开成功后出现表格,选择你要导入的表格,点击下一步
5.出现源表  目标表  新建表,根据你的需求选择,然后选择下一上
6.点击开始,导入完成
参考技术B 楼上的答案有用

以上是关于怎么将数据导入到mysql数据库中的主要内容,如果未能解决你的问题,请参考以下文章

怎么将MySQL里的表数据导入到SqlServer里面

1200万 mysql数据怎么快速导入到Mongodb

mysql怎样将一个数据库中的数据导入到另一个数据库中

将Sql Server中的数据导入到Mysql数据库中

vs2010 将mysql中数据导入到MFC列表中显示乱码

如何将一个mysql数据库中的一个表导入到另一个mysql数据库中